Nokia 9, 7, and 2 Rumoured to Launch Early Next Year at WMC 2018

Rahul Krishnan • Updated October 11, 2017 • 3 min read • Leave a Comment

Nokia has made a flamboyant comeback this year with four phones; Nokia 3, 5, 6, and the legendary 3310. They also launched the first Android flagship Nokia 8 this year. Guess what? The HMD Global-helmed company is not going to settle down.

According to a report that came out recently, the company is going to release their next flagship, dubbed as Nokia 9. Alongside the flagship beast, they might also reveal other two smartphones (most probably Nokia 2 and 7) in the beginning of next year at Mobile World Congress, Barcelona.

The rumors and speculations on both Nokia 2 and 9 aren’t new to the gadget enthusiasts. However, Nokia 7 (most probably the mid-range) is a new entrant.

When it comes to the specifications, Nokia 9 might come up with a 3D bezel-less display. The Nokia 8 disappointed almost everyone with its wider bezels. Hence, it is essential for the company to follow the trend. The 5.7-inch display also offers a quad-HD resolution, thanks to the leaks. Although many sources didn’t mention the processor, some quote it as Snapdragon 835. Given Nokia 9 is company’s flagship, we don’t think HMD Global will look for other options.

Most probably, we will see the device coming in both 6 GB and 8 GB RAM variants, coupled with 128 GB onboard storage. It is unsure whether or not they include memory expansion. But the sure thing is it will have a dual rear camera setup and a fingerprint scanner. We also expect the smartphone to come up with an iris scanner too.

Not much about the Nokia 7 is known now. Chances are it replaces Nokia 6 from this year with mid-range specifications. If it happens, HMD won’t price it over Rs. 20000.

Nokia 2 aims the entry-level smartphone users. You might have already read many leaks about it. It will reportedly sport a 5-inch display with 720p resolution. Digging deep, the processor might be 1.27 GHz Qualcomm Snapdragon 210, which accompanies 1/2GB of RAM. If the rumors turn out true, Nokia 2 will have a 4000 mAh battery, 8 MP rear, and 5 MP front cameras.

To recall, Nokia 8 is the current flagship device from HMD Global. It has a 5.3-inch 2K IPS LCD display. Powered by Snapdragon 835 coupled with 6 GB of RAM, it bears a special audio feature named Ozo Audio for spatial recording. Although the shipped OS is Nougat, the company promised a quick Oreo update.
